We're delighted to present an upcoming Pocket Exhibition by Robyn Fleet. Through quiet, contemplative paintings of figures, animals, trees and shifting landscapes, Robyn explores perception, solitude and the spaces between memory and presence. Inviting slow looking and reflection, The Observer Observing considers what it means to notice, witness and be seen.

A Room of Women | Laurette Looker Pocket Exhibition | 28 May - 13 June

A Room of Women explores stillness, reflection, and quiet strength through a series of contemplative female figures rendered in bold colour and dreamlike settings. Together, the works create a calm and introspective atmosphere, inviting viewers to slow down and sit with what might otherwise go unnoticed.

Natural Phenomena | Melanie Field Solo Exhibition | 29 April - 16 May

In this body of work, Melanie Field explores intuition, surrender, and transformation through layered, atmospheric paintings that evolve through multiple iterations. Moving between earthy, shadowed tones and luminous, veiled compositions, the works invite viewers into immersive realms shaped by sensation, memory, and the quiet tension between darkness and illumination.

Home.land | Aida Smith Pocket Exhibition | 12 - 28 March 2026

As part of our Pocket Exhibition series, Home.land by Aida Smith presents a focused body of work exploring the deep connection between people and place. Drawing on landscapes across New Zealand, Smith reflects on memory, belonging, and the lasting imprint of home through quietly evocative paintings rendered in her soft, restrained palette.
